    I reviewed this solid Sebring staple 9 years ago and I'm still visiting! Time for an update. Arriving- It's on the northbound side of US Route 27 at a very busy intersection with no light so be careful! The parking lot is adequate during the day but a problem on busy nights. Ambience- This is one of those Dive Bar+ places. It's a step up from your typical dive with much much better food choices. Expect old Florida kitsch and an unbelievable number of TVs. It's a perfect place to watch a game. Split Personality- Day and night experiences are entirely different here. By day the crowd is older, more sedate, and orders more food. Nights can get wild, especially Friday and Saturday! Much younger crowds, let's say under 35, heavy drinking, and a little rowdy at times. You'll definitely think "Dive Bar" at night! Pro Tip- One of the few places in Highlands County that is open 11 am to 2 am every day! The kitchen stays open until 1 am every night. It beats the hell out of fast food! Customer Service- The owners choose to go with pretty ladies showing lots of skin as servers. Fortunately, they also look for competence and I've rarely had a problem. The servers work as a team here so you may be touched by two or three. Food- Huge menu for a small restaurant! There is a ton of fried food and they do it well but there's lots of other choices. Expect to see burgers, seafood. salads and they are well known for their wings! BTW- The Nachos are spot-on and awesome for sharing. I went with their Skipjack sandwich @ $9.50. It normally comes with house-made chips, but I switched to fries for a $3 upcharge. Pro Tip- Although unclear on the menu, their standard fries have Cajun seasoning and a little kick. Now you're informed! My meal was easily five stars. It was super flavorful and moist pulled chipotle chicken, and spicy cheese, on a perfectly toasted pretzel bun. The fries were amazing with a nice outside crunch and piping hot. Check out my close up pic and try not to drool! So, I had a 5-star meal, and my servers were just fine. I'd like to give them 4.5 stars but I'm going for 4. If there is a big game on, go very early or expect parking to be a nightmare. Also, you need to be ready for the atmosphere, especially the day to night personality change. It's a shock to some folks.

    I always love it when a new restaurant opens in my Highlands County and this place debuted in…read moreNovember. It's a little off the beaten path for me and I'm a lazy ass so it took me until this weekend to get there! Arriving- It's in the clubhouse of the North Golf Course in the Highland's Ridge Community. Follow the signs for that clubhouse or let your GPS do the work. If you are familiar with the area, it was formally The Tavern. Ambience- So this is what a lot of folks would call a Country Club restaurant. As I had patronized the old tenants, I was curious how they were going to transform it into an Irish Pub. The answer is they didn't! It looks nothing like and Irish Pub. It's a large space with lots of natural light and traditional furniture. It has lots of outside seating that's covered with ceiling fans and many seats have a nice view! There is a very small bar that seats about six. In short, it looks like a Country Club restaurant. So much for pub ambience! Customer Service- Awesome, maybe seven stars! I had substantial interactions with the manager, bartender, and a server. All were exceptional. Adult Libations- Definitely not a pub style bar. It's a full bar with just a few taps but nothing special. Food- Like the ambience, it's an American menu with a couple of Irish dishes. There's Bangers & Mash and Shepard's Pie. Other than that, they throw in a couple of Irish terms to deceive you but it's really an American menu. There're enough choices to satisfy most folks. See their website. I ordered Irish Brisket Flatbread- Brisket, bacon, caramelized onions, diced tomatoes, BBQ sauce, mozzarella cheese @ $13. It was out in good time and plated very nicely. Plenty of food for the price so good value. The flatbread was nicely crisp. I love caramelized onions and that's the base here. Everything was very fresh. Plenty of brisket. Unfortunately, the onions overpowered the other ingredients, so the flavors were not balanced. It was tasty but needed a little work to be a winner. Conclusion- If you're looking for an Irish Pub, you're in the wrong place. If you're looking for an American menu that has some potential with a great staff and beautiful outside seating, give it a try. As they are new and the staff is awesome combined with the outside seating, I'm going to be a little charitable and say four stars!
